Chinaunix首页 | 论坛 | 博客
  • 博客访问: 243408
  • 博文数量: 29
  • 博客积分: 634
  • 博客等级: 上士
  • 技术积分: 432
  • 用 户 组: 普通用户
  • 注册时间: 2010-10-09 22:24
文章分类

全部博文(29)

文章存档

2012年(8)

2011年(21)

分类: LINUX

2011-06-20 14:36:58

第一步下载软件,
wget
(wget )
第二步,安装,

tar -zxvf subversion-1.6.11.tar.gz

tar -zxvf subversion-deps-1.6.11.tar.gz

cd subversion-1.6.11

./configure   --prefix=/usr/local/webserver/subversion --with-ssl   --enable-maintainer-mode
make && make install

第三步配置,

 mkdir -p /var/svn/mytest

svnadmin create /var/svn/mytest

cd var/svn/mytest/conf

vi passwd

 

  1. [users]
  2. # harry = harryssecret
  3. # sally = sallyssecret
  4. yangyong = abc123 //添加的用户

 vi authz

 

  1. [groups]
  2. # harry_and_sally = harry,sally
  3. admin = yangyong //管理员用户
  4. [/foo/bar]
  5. # harry = rw
  6. # * =
  7. yangyong = rw //用户权限
  8. [repository:/baz/fuz]
  9. # @harry_and_sally = rw
  10. # * = r
  11. @admin = rw
  12. [/mytest]
  13. yangyong = rw

vi svnserve.conf

 

  1. [general]
  2. anon-access = none
  3. auth-access = write
  4. password-db = /var/svn/mytest/conf/passwd
  5. authz-db = /var/svn/mytest/conf/authz
  6. # realm = My First Repository

 

第四步启动端口,

svnserve -d -r /var/svn/mytest --listen-port 3312

 vi /etc/sysconfig/iptables

-A RH-Firewall-1-INPUT -m state --state NEW -m tcp -p tcp --dport 3312 -j ACCEPT

第五步在win下添加仓库文件,

输入地址就可以对仓库进行填装

阅读(1986) | 评论(0) | 转发(1) |
给主人留下些什么吧!~~